‘Remember Beach’: Arrowhead has awarded thousands of ‘inexplicably dedicated’ Helldivers 2 players with a commemorative ‘Avengement Day’ after they ignored High Command to save a planet reminiscent of Halo Reach

Despite major orders to go and spend their lives elsewhere, an estimated 30,000 Helldivers 2 players took a liking to a planet with some oblique Halo references—Seyshel Beach—and decided to finish the fight. The socials team at Arrowhead congratulated the “small but inexplicably dedicated group of Helldivers” with, as befits a bloodthirsty star-spanning democracy, a…

With a lawsuit looming, World of Warcraft private server Turtle WoW has issued a formal plea for a fan server licensing: ‘We hope that Blizzard embraces fan‑driven content as its own legacy, rather than alienate this passionate community’

Turtle WoW—a fanmade, souped-up take on World of Warcraft Classic with new character customization options and zones—is like a lot of MMO private servers in that it took years of work across a dozen modding disciplines to make it a reality. Unfortunately, it became so successful that it caught the attention of the original game’s…
